Blackpearl Group has appointed Jean-Francois Arlove as its new chief financial officer, effective 15 October, while current CFO Karen Cargill becomes chief governance officer.

NZX-listed Blackpearl last week announced it would undertake a $10 million capital raise after it reached $10.4 million in annual recurring revenue.

“Having experienced exponential growth, it’s a critical time to focus on the key roles that will help us build a solid platform for continued expansion,” CEO and founder Nick Lissette said of the appointments.

Arlove has extensive experience in CFO and COO roles within the advertising and marketing industries and has been a practicing accountant for over two decades.

“As a business, Blackpearl Group is at an inflection point and now is the time to ensure our systems and processes are designed to scale,” Arlove said.

Arlove said he plans to use a data-driven leadership style to empower the team to iterate quickly around impactful decisions that align the company’s strategic objectives and priorities.

As chief governance officer, Cargill will step away from day-to-day financial management to focus on the company’s governance. She will, however, tap into her significant global audit experience to deliver the company’s NZX financial reporting.

Cargill played a key role in driving Blackpearl Group’s NZX listing in December 2022.

The company’s core product, dubbed Pearl Diver, shows businesses the individuals visiting their websites, including the visitor’s name, contact numbers, email addresses, physical addresses, job information and more. It also offers an email signature generator, New Old Stamp.

In December 2023, Blackpearl announced it was recruiting partners to take those products to market after launching a partner programme that September.
